ALBERT GALLATIN MUNI AUTH (PWSID PA5260027) is a cws water system drawing from a surface water source, regulated by the EPA Safe Drinking Water Information System (SDWIS) under the Safe Drinking Water Act. It serves approximately 2,695 people in Point Marion, PA, and is subject to primacy enforcement by the Pennsylvania drinking-water program.

The system's federal compliance record contains 37 total violations, with 37 classified as health-based (MCL exceedances or treatment-technique failures). 2 distinct contaminants have been cited, including Haloacetic Acids (HAA5), Fluoride. Recorded violations span 2015–2025.

A historical violation does not necessarily describe current water quality, systems must notify customers and remediate, and monitoring-type violations often reflect reporting lapses rather than contamination. The most authoritative real-time source is the utility's annual Consumer Confidence Report. For enforcement history and corrective-action orders, consult EPA ECHO and the Pennsylvania state drinking-water program's public portal.
